The Engineering Shift: Why Spiral Bevel Beats Worm Gear

In intensive aquaculture, Dissolved Oxygen (DO) management is the critical factor determining stocking density and yield. Traditional Paddlewheel Aerators have long relied on Worm Gearboxes. However, worm gear transmission is fundamentally based on sliding friction, resulting in mechanical efficiencies often hovering between 50% and 65%. For farmers, this means nearly half of their electricity bill is converted into useless heat rather than water-moving mechanical energy. In the South Korean market, particularly in the large-scale aquaculture bases of Jeollanam-do and Gyeongsangnam-do, this represents a massive hidden operational cost.

1. Power Standards & Energy Subsidies

The Korean industrial power standard is 220V/380V, 60Hz. Our gearbox ratios (1:14/1:16) are precisely calculated to match 4-pole motor speeds at 60Hz (approx. 1750 RPM), ensuring impeller speeds stay in the optimal aeration zone (105-110 RPM). Furthermore, our >95% efficiency qualifies our units as “High-Efficiency Energy Equipment” under Korean government standards, helping farmers apply for agricultural electricity subsidies.

2. Corrosion Challenges in the Yellow Sea

Addressing the high-salinity aquaculture environments of Korea’s West Coast (e.g., Taean-gun, Chungcheongnam-do), we employ a “Triple Protection” process: Electrophoretic primer + Epoxy topcoat housing (passing >500 hours salt spray test), 40Cr Hard Chrome plated output shafts, and 304 Stainless Steel for all external fasteners. This ensures long-term resistance to sea breeze and saltwater corrosion.

3. Cold Climate Startup Performance

Korean winters can be severe. Standard gear oil can thicken, causing startup overloads. We recommend and supply fully synthetic gear oil suitable for -20°C environments and have optimized gear backlash to ensure smooth cold starts in regions like Gangwon-do, preventing gear tooth breakage.

Q2: What type of oil does this gearbox need, and how often should I change it?

We recommend high-quality industrial gear oil, specification SAE 90 or ISO VG 220. To flush out micro-metal particles from the break-in period, we advise changing the oil after the first 300-500 hours. Afterward, under normal conditions, change it every 2500-3000 hours or at the end of each farming season.

Q4: Is your gearbox noisy? Will it affect the fish/shrimp?

It is very quiet. This is a core advantage of the Spiral Bevel design. Unlike the impact meshing of straight gears, spiral bevels engage gradually, running smoothly. Our gearbox noise is controlled below 75dB, which is friendly to worker hearing and significantly reduces stress on noise-sensitive aquatic species.
